Rams Tickets Go Defense
While Rams ticket holders have long been used to a staggeringly good offense,
plans to beef up the offensive line went out the window after Miami stole the
thunder. So Head Coach Scott Linehan went on to fill the Rams next biggest need
by drafting Chris Long, defensive lineman from Virginia with the second pick in
the NFL Draft. Long should be a big boost to a position that registered less
than six sacks all last season, posting 14 from his inside position at Virginia.
Keeping opposing teams offense off the field keeps the Rams still potent offense
ON the field, a fact Rams ticket holders have begun to appreciate as of late.
Rams Tickets Go Offense
Speaking of that offense, the Rams didn’t wait around to make moves designed to
keep it humming. Looking for speed at the wide receiver position, St. Louis
tapped Donnie Avery, a speed freak from the University of Houston, to do double
duty offensively and on special teams. Running a 4.3, Avery had 91 catches in
his last year in college. He may make just as big a mark on the return side of
the game, a position the Rams have been filling with marginal performers the
past few years.

TOP 10 REASONS TO BUY ST. LOUIS RAMS TICKETS
10. High-flying O: The Rams' high-flying offense has been called The Greatest
Show on Turf, and you have to see it in person to understand why. St. Louis has
set numerous offensive records in recent years, lighting up the scoreboard like
a pinball machine.
9. Scott Linehan: Head coach Scott Linehan enters his second season after
guiding the Rams to an 8-8 record in 2006, including a three-game win streak to
finish the season. He is known as an offensive expert and previously coordinated
potent attacks in Minnesota and Miami.
8. Rockin' Dome: St. Louis Rams tickets are your chance to experience the
scintillating atmosphere inside the Edwards Jones Dome, which opened in 1995.
The stadium is almost always sold out by loyal Rams
fans.
7. Winnersville: Few teams have enjoyed the consistent success of the Rams, who
own 15 division titles, six conference titles and a Super Bowl championship
following the 1999 season.
6. Marc Bulger: The cool, calculating leader of the Rams is quarterback Marc
Bulger, who has established himself as one of the NFL's best. Bulger earned MVP
honors in the 2004 Pro Bowl and later reached 1,000 completions faster than any
quarterback in NFL history.
5. Steven Jackson: St. Louis Rams tickets are the best way to enjoy the bruising
poetry of running back Steven Jackson, the Rams' first-round pick in 2004. In
2006, Jackson broke out with 2,334 yards from scrimmage, leading the NFL in that
category.
4. The Rev. Ike: There is one player remaining who was a Los Angeles Ram and is
now a St. Louis Ram. That is wide out Isaac Bruce, the most precise route runner
in the NFL. Bruce has more than 12,000 receiving yards and is nicknamed The
Reverend because he wants to be a minister after he retires from football.
3. Hall of Famers: The Rams franchise, which began in Cleveland and moved to Los
Angeles before finding a home in St. Louis, has placed many players into the
Hall of Fame, notably Eric Dickerson, Deacon Jones and Elroy "Crazy Legs"
Hirsch.
2. Inspiration: The Rams inspired the nation with their Cinderella 1999 season,
when they went from last place to Super Bowl champions. They were led by former
grocery stock boy Kurt Warner, and featured the most exciting offense the NFL
had seen in decades.
1. Torry Holt: Torry "Big Play" Holt is one of the best receivers in the NFL. A
Super Bowl champion in his rookie season of 1999, he currently has 712 catches
for 10,675 yards. He is a perennial Pro-Bowler and a fan favorite.

The 1999 Super Bowl Champions, the St. Louis Rams returned to the Super Bowl in
2001 only to have to face Tom Brady and a
New England Patriots team, who made history by being only the second team in
NFL history to win three Super Bowls in only four years. The exit of quarterback
Kurt Warner after the 2002 season, when he went to the
New
York Giants made room for young and exciting quarterback Marc Bulger, who
seemingly came out of no where to lead the Rams into a respectable winning
franchise after the injuries and drop off in Warner’s game.
